在Linux上实现iSCSI服务(iscsi服务linux)

Linux是目前最流行的操作系统之一,且已经被越来越多的企业用于建立大型的内部网络。 iSCSI(Internet Small Computer System Interface)服务器是一种用于在网络中共享存储的常用技术,它可以极大地简化企业网络中的存储管理,并将企业存储向大型企业层次拓展。实现Linux上的iSCSI服务器不是什么复杂的技术,本文将详细介绍如何在Linux上实现iSCSI服务器。

首先,要在Linux上实现iSCSI服务器,我们需要安装iSCSI服务器软件包,如LIO(Linux-iSCSI.org)和TGT(SCSI Target Framework)。LIO和TGT都是用于实现iSCSI服务器会话的框架。安装其中一个即可,但建议两者兼容使用,以获得更好的性能和安全性。

接下来,我们需要配置iSCSI网络。首先,对服务器进行网络配置,即指定静态IP地址,设置路由表等。其次,需要为服务器上的iSCSI服务器设置一个可用端口号。最后,需要安装客户端,以进行iSCSI连接。系统中应安装如Open-iSCSI等客户端软件。

此外,还需要创建iSCSI实体。要在服务器上创建iSCSI实体,可以使用iscsiadm工具创建和管理实体。示例如下:

iscsiadm -m node -T iqn.1994-06.com.example:node1 -p 192.168.0.100 -l

其中,iqn.1994-06.com.example:node1为创建的iSCSI实体的唯一识别名称,192.168.0.100为实体所在的IP地址。

在完成上述步骤之后,iSCSI服务器将准备就绪,可以提供iSCSI存储服务。只要连接上客户端,就可以访问远程存储了。

以上就是在Linux上实现iSCSI服务器的步骤。如果您希望在Linux上实现iSCSI服务器,请务必按照上述步骤操作,以便更轻松地实现iSCSI服务器功能。


数据运维技术 » 在Linux上实现iSCSI服务(iscsi服务linux)